Output ea0113883955e4498f8a134754657431bd158698c17d18f52d47ba8181388248:38

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d12cb96adc6a7fb980a8e5dd1b6eb240ee5e69686940488201bb46a84e02aba2
address
bc1p6yktj6kudflmnq9guhw3km4jgrh9u6tgd9qy3qsphdr2snsz4w3qnmhg4k
transaction
ea0113883955e4498f8a134754657431bd158698c17d18f52d47ba8181388248
spent
true